Jewell County, Kansas Electricity Overview
There was a 3.83% decrease in CO2 emissions per capita over the preceding year in Jewell County.
While the national average residential rate of electricity is 16.62 cents per kilowatt hour, Jewell County's average price is 13.67% above that at 18.90 cents per kilowatt hour.
The largest electricity supplier in Jewell County by total customers is Rolling Hills Electric Cooperative.
Jewell County is the 3052nd most populated county in the United States, with 2,927 residents .
Jewell County released 13,338,186.16 kilograms of CO2 gases due to electricity use, which makes it the 62nd worst polluting county in Kansas.
Jewell County is the 33rd worst polluting county in Kansas when considering pollution per capita.

FAQ
What electricity company is the largest provider in Jewell County, Kansas?
By total customer count, Rolling Hills Electric Cooperative is the largest electricity supplier in Jewell County, Kansas.
How many electric companies offer service in Jewell County, Kansas?
There are 2 electricity companies serving customers in Jewell County, Kansas.
What electricity companies offer service in Jewell County, Kansas?
County Customers Rank | Provider | Est. County Customers |
---|---|---|
1 | Rolling Hills Electric Cooperative | 1,680 |
2 | Prairie Land Electric Cooperative | 343 |
